Analysis of needs from the Human Scale Development Theory: the case of two vulnerable neighbourhoods of Valencian Region (Spain)
Main Article Content
Abstract
The analysis of axiological needs and their satisfactors presented below, has its origin in the results obtained from a research started in 2016 which at present is been expanded towards others international locations. The purpose of this article is to compare, from the approach to the Human Scale Development Theory of Max-Neef, Elizalde and Hopenhayn, the social needs of the Xenillet neighborhood (Torrent, Valencia) and the neighborhood of La Coma (Paterna, Valencia), proposing the neutralization of destructive satisfiers and enhancing the real satisfactors from a critical analysis of the results obtained. The research, carried out from a community perspective, offers a great diversity of opinions and references from the different areas of community agents: citizen, technical and professional and the Public Administration. Specifically, the completion of the matrix is based on the community of the neighborhood of La Coma and the Xenillet neighborhood.
